>> This looks amazing, but I'm having a small problem... when I try to
>> remove a book so I can replace it with an updated copy, specifying the
>> path the the homepage.cfg file on my local copy of docs.fp.org, I get
>> the following error:
>>
>> DEBUG: Publican: config loaded
>> DB file '/home/rlandmann/Documents/books/Fedora/web/fedoradocs.db' not
>> found. at /usr/bin/publican line 775
>>
>> My local copy of docs.fp.org is up-to-date, with the required
>> homepage.cfg and fedoradocs.db.
>>
>>     
> I've encountered this problem earlier today, and I worked around it by
> locally modifying homepage.cfg to point to actual fedoradocs.db and
> public_html. Although the need of absolute path seems to be a bug to me.
